Abstract EN
This work aims to establish a research method to find the optimal exploitation of the Remote Terminal Units (RTUs) in order to optimize reliability and operations in electrical distribution networks, this optimum is determined in two steps: 1) determination of the optimal choices of the substation to be remotely controlled, 2) the optimal number of substations, i.e.
the optimal investment.
For this, a multi-criteria optimization method combining a probabilistic approach and the Analytical Hierarchical Process was adopted to determine the principal points of the network; subsequently, a cost/worth analysis study was done to determine the optimal investment.
